C B Bhave takes charge as the new SEBI chief
Mumbai, Feb 18 (UNI) Chandrasekher Bhaskar Bhave has taken the charge of the Chairman of Indian market regulator, Securities and Exchange Board of India (SEBI) for next three years.
Outgoing SEBI Chairman M Damodaran, who completed his three-year tenure on February 17, welcomed Mr Bhave to the office this morning and handed over the charge to him.
Mr Bhave, a former civil servent, had headed the country's leading depository, National Securities Depository Limited (NSDL) and was one of the first senior executive directors to come on SEBI's board.
Apart from a short stint as head of the primary market department during 1995-96, he had also been in-charge of SEBI's secondary market division between 1992 and 1996 and was closely associated with the development of online trading in securities.
